技术文摘
基于 pandas 的数据移动计算应用
2024-12-31 01:23:52 小编
基于 pandas 的数据移动计算应用
在当今数据驱动的时代,高效处理和分析数据至关重要。Pandas 作为 Python 中强大的数据处理库,为数据移动计算提供了丰富而便捷的功能。
数据移动计算是指在数据集中对数据进行位置的调整、排序、筛选等操作,以满足特定的分析需求。Pandas 提供了多种方法来实现这些操作。
例如,通过 sort_values 方法可以对数据进行排序。无论是按照单个列还是多个列的组合进行排序,都能轻松实现。这对于发现数据中的趋势和规律非常有用。
筛选数据也是常见的需求。Pandas 的 loc 和 iloc 方法可以根据条件精确地选取所需的数据行。比如,我们可以筛选出特定时间段内的销售数据,或者满足特定条件的用户信息。
数据的移动和重组也是重要的操作。shift 方法可以将数据行或列进行上下或左右的移动,这在时间序列数据处理中经常用到。例如,通过移动数据来计算相邻时间段的数据差异。
concat 函数可以将多个数据框连接在一起,实现数据的合并和扩展。而 merge 则用于根据特定的键将两个数据框进行关联和合并。
在实际应用中,基于 Pandas 的数据移动计算为数据分析和处理带来了极大的便利。以金融领域为例,分析股票价格的波动时,可以对历史数据进行排序和筛选,找出特定时间段内价格涨幅最大的股票。在市场营销中,通过筛选和重组用户购买行为数据,能够精准地定位目标客户群体。
Pandas 的数据移动计算功能是数据处理和分析的有力工具。掌握这些功能,能够更高效地从海量数据中提取有价值的信息,为决策提供有力支持。无论是在学术研究、商业分析还是其他领域,Pandas 都发挥着重要的作用,帮助我们更好地理解和利用数据。
- Golang 中 strconv 包常用函数与用法深度解析
- Golang 操作 Kafka 中消息失效时间的设置方法
- 基于 Go goroutine 的并发 Clock 服务实现
- 脚本与批处理融合一体
- 两个详尽的 Shell 实例代码
- Golang 内存管理中的内存分配器剖析
- npm 脚本与 package.json 详解
- 当前页脚本错误的解决之法汇总
- Golang 数组拷贝的三种实现方式及性能剖析
- Perl 与 Python 的部分异同梳理
- 深度剖析 Golang 中 strconv 库的使用方法
- 入门级 shell 脚本优质教程
- Linux Shell 学习笔记终章:温故而知新
- Go 时间格式化的实现方法
- 深度剖析 Go 语言切片的底层原理